Output d61faead550e33509a7d52d2d1902df3c905ec997beb29042b7f5a85d7ff2b27:0

value
235483738
script pubkey
OP_0 OP_PUSHBYTES_20 de63ccf01dbbbea6032b57f547a45d140c96a307
address
bc1qme3ueuqahwl2vqet2l650fzazsxfdgc8lhm6pw
transaction
d61faead550e33509a7d52d2d1902df3c905ec997beb29042b7f5a85d7ff2b27
confirmations
145279
spent
true